500cc MX World Championship Series:
Round 9
Malherbe, Thorpe duel
in British GP
By Alex Hodgkinson
FARLEIGH CASTL E. EN"GLAND, J ULY H
O vercast skies a nd overall victory for defending W orld Ch a mp ion A n dre Ma l he rbe
co ul d n' t da mpen the sp iri ts of 21,000 Br itish
spectators at Farleigh Cas tl e on Sunday as

Brit David T h orpe produced
two epic ri des to mai ntai n h is
.
.
15 po i n t a dvantage In the
Wo rld C hampionshi p point
standings.
H aving ueat~n Ma lh erbe after a
race-long due l III malO one, Thorpe
had to be content with a reversa l of
the placings in mow tw o , thus giv ing
th e G P 10 Malh erbe, but T horpe
went home both th e m o ral a nd psy ch o logica l w in ner.
Milli on s o f TV viewers j oin ed th e
Farl ei gh faithful i n ex pe r ienci ng live
the r id e o f a lifetim e whi ch sa w th e
Br it ish cha m p taken down in th e fir st
tu rn a t th e sta rt o f th e second m o to ,
rem ount with th e pa ck go ne a n d , o n
a tr ack w here passin g is su p posed to
be next to i m poss ib le, power pa st th e
ent ire field, includ in g Malh erbe, to
tak e th e lead within four laps . Nin e
minutes from last to fir st!
Dampen ed by a sho we r immedi at eIy before th e sta rt , th e tr ack was
in cr edib ly slipper y but that didn't
slo w Th orpe: " I know I have to get to
th e fro nt a n d stay if I'm going to w in
th e tit le. I think I wa s sid eways mos t
o f th e time."
Even his riv a ls h ad to pa y tribute to
Tho rpe's performance. G eorges Jobe,
bitt er ly di sappo inted with h is ea rl y
d eparture from mot a o ne with a
broken gearbox, had to co pe with a
mu ch cha nged as we ll as s lip pery
tr ack , bu t gra ciousl y ad m itte d a t th e
cl o se, " T he rest o f us were just find in g o u r wa y round as David flew
pas t. U n bel ieva ble. Today h e was so
g ood,"
T he effo rt wa s bound to tak e its
toll . however, a n d Malh erbe took th e
lead a fte r 30 minutes to receive th e
checke red flag firs t at th e en d of a
ti tan ic battl e in w hi ch Thorpe tw ice
momentaril y got his n ose ba ck in
front aga in a nd h e on ly ga ve up hope
o f th e win a fte r a la st ditch effo rt a t a
hairpin turn o n th e final lap ca me to
nau ght.
" J'd rath er have been 21 points i n
front ," sa id Th orpe, " b u t a fte r th at
sta rt , I've got to be happy wi th what
I've got."
It seeme d a n eterru tv a fte r th e fiv e
second bo ard in race ' o ne was dis pla yed before the gate dropped a nd
Mich ele Maga rouo and Wa tson u n leashed th e power of th ei r Kawasaki s
to take th e lead.
Ton y R iddell ws soon picking him self up a fter being ch o p ped on th e
first turn as wer e Willi e Simpson,
C hris Main d onal d a n d Rob Andrews
a fter tangl in g on th e app roach to
th e Bri d g e, a n d A nd re Vrorn ans a nd
Wern er Siegle a t th e bottom of th e
bi g hill.
H o nd a ' s Malherb e to ok third from
Mervyn An sti e u p th e h ill , seco nd
from Watson a t th e bottom o f t he
next d escen t a n d th e lead fro m Ma ga rot~o before swee p ing back into the
m am are na .
Several p laces furth er back a t th e
sta rt, Honda 's Thorpe was fourth by
the en d of the lap but had even d isplaced the c ha m p io n as th ey complet ed lap two,
J obe was al so p ast h is .Ka wasa ki
teammat es for third on la p three but
it n ever sh owed o n th e lap cha r ts as
g earbox tr oub les eliminated him
before th e co m p letio n of th e lap .
W ith Er ik G eboers a lready recovering from th e first of two falls , which,
together with two delays as he sta lle d ,
m ade it a topsy-turvy ra ce for th e Bel gi an , all cha l lenge to th e tw o tit le
ca nd ida tes was go ne but what a ra ce
th ey p roduced .
"Andre is the most difficu lt rid er in
th e world to sh ak e off. H e is so go od
at lea rn in g lines from yo u quickly
a nd durin g th e race I co u ld n' t hel p
thinkin g a bo u t H oll and, wh en he
got by m e near th e end ," sa id Th orpe.
" I had saved eno ugh energ y 10 go
aga in if he got too cl ose but in th e end
it wasn't necessary."
In fact, Malh erbe got int o a wobbl e
in the woods with one-and-a -h alf
laps to go and. seei ng Thorpe disapp eari ng into th e d istan ce, gav e up
hope. H e had no need to worry a bout
a n y oppo si ti on becau se, d espite a
m agnifi cent ride, Maga rotto wa s o ver
a minute behind.
